Small Animal Saturday
Most guinea pigs don't like the water. A Bath can actually result in stress that can be unhealthy for your pet and they should not be bathed unless they absolutely need it.
Instead try one of the following:
Powder baths can be sprinkle on and brush out with a bristle brush.
Spot clean fur with a washcloth and warm soapy water.

The moral of the story...... Do a lot of thinking before you purchase a pet. Try to take every part of your life into consideration. How much space do you have, how much time and care will he need? If you rent or are part of a community such as condos what are the rules for pets. Never buy a new pet on impulse!
